Beahm reunion slated
The annual reunion celebrated by relatives and friends of the late George Washington Beahm and Nancy Bolen Beahm will be held at the Rappahannock Park near Washington beginning at 11 a.m. Table covers, eating utensils and coffee will be provided. Those attending should bring a picnic lunch or covered dish and drink of your choice to share. Dinner will be served at 1 p.m.
Artist's work on display
Ms. Eunice Wenger will have her work on display at Middle Street Galley in Washington during the month of September. The opening reception will be Sept. 5 from 2 until 6 p.m., and the show will run through Sept. 26. Middle Street Gallery is open from 11 a.m. until 6 p.m. Friday through Sunday.

RoughRide scheduled
The third annual Rappahannock RoughRide will be held at 10 a.m. in Washington on Sept. 18. A charity, “Tour de Rappahannock” with three different routes will benefit the Fauquier Free Clinic, which provides health care for the residents of Rappahannock and Fauquier counties. Program offers help to quit smoking
Need help to quit smoking? Becoming a non-smoker is hard, but with the right tools and support, it’s not impossible. Warren Memorial Hospital offers Quit for Good, an eight-week smoking cessation program designed to help smokers prepare to quit, quit and maintain a non-smoking lifestyle.
